**Ceremony checklist, item 12 — Parceline webhook signing key.** Reviewer, heads up: this is the step where we cut over the parcel-tracking webhook to the new signing key minted earlier in the ceremony. Double-check that the Norvale relay is draining before rotation, otherwise in-flight delivery events get signed with a dead key and retries pile up. Once rotated, verify one synthetic tracking event end-to-end and initial the log. If the HSM session drops mid-rotation, recovery needs the escrow phrase recorded below.

unlock words, hahip-baduf: holwyn-istath-julvan

This PR introduces the Fennwick schema registry for our event bus. Producers must register Avro schemas before publishing; compatibility mode is backward-transitive by default. I added retry logic around registry lookups and a local cache to avoid hot-path latency. Please scrutinize the eviction behavior carefully. The cache and retry constants are defined as follows.

tuning table, yajog-yahof:
BUDGETS = {
    "lamvan": 303,
    "wenox": 460,
    "fenvan": 525,
}

Handover for the sync: role-based access on the Quillbase wiki is now enforced at the page-tree level. Editors inherit from space roles; the old per-page overrides are deprecated but still honored until the migration script runs next week. Priya finished the audit of orphaned permissions — about forty pages need owners assigned. Nothing is blocking, but don't create new overrides. The role matrix and migration schedule are on the internal page below.

wiki page, fahaf-yagag: https://confluence.qorvellabs.internal/pages/display/pages/display

- [ ] Step 7: Archive cold storage buckets (Glacierline tier). Confirm both ceremony witnesses are present, verify bucket manifests match the Oxbow ledger, then seal the archive key shares. Plugin authors may observe but not handle shares. Once sealed, the archive index itself is encrypted and can only be reopened with the passphrase below.

vault phrase of badup-hahig = tamael-aldael-kelmir-istael-fenok-istwyn-tamius-jorath-oliion